The
action-comedy manga Kill Blue surprised fans by announcing
that it will feature an anime adaptation scheduled to premiere in 2026.
The announcement was accompanied by a first teaser, a promotional
illustration and the confirmation of the main team behind the project.
Production
team revealed
The series
will be directed by Hiro Kaburagi, known for his work on Kimi
ni Todoke, under the production of the animation studio CUE. The
character designs will be in charge of Miho Daidoji, who will bring
the peculiar aesthetic of the work to life.

About
the Kill Blue manga
Tadatoshi
Fujimaki, also
author of Kuroko no Basket, began publishing Kill Blue in Weekly
Shonen Jump magazine in April 2023. The work recently concluded with
the release of its final chapter, accumulating to date 10 compilation
volumes in Japan, while volume 11 will arrive in bookstores on September
4VIZ Media is in charge of its English edition.
Synopsis
of Kill Blue
The story
follows Jūzō Ōgami, a legendary 39-year-old assassin who has never
failed a mission. However, after eliminating a powerful organization, he is
attacked by a mysterious wasp that knocks him unconscious. When he wakes up, he
discovers that his body has been rejuvenated to that of a 13-year-old teenager.
Forced by his boss, he must infiltrate a high school, facing a student life
full of chaos, eccentric classmates, and constant threats. Will it be able to
regain its original form or will it be removed before it succeeds?
